Bowhead is Hiring a Linux Systems Administrator (Red Hat) Near Dahlgren, VA

Overview

LINUX ADMINISTRATOR (Red Hat) (RDTE)

Bowhead seeks a Linux Administrator (Red Hat) to join our team in Dahlgren, VA. The Linux Administrator (Red Hat) is responsible for system administration and customer support of servers and workstations in a Research, Development, and Testing and Evaluation (RDT&E) environment. 

Responsibilities

  • Utilize Red Hat Enterprise Linux system administration experience to provide technical problem solving and in-depth consulting relative to system operations 
  • Automate installation methods and system imaging (e.g. Kickstart/Ansible) 
  • Use cryptographic experience to set up public key infrastructure (PKI) to create, manage, distribute, use, store, and revoke digital certificates and manage public-key encryption 
  • DISA STIG implementation and work within Configuration-Managed Environments
  • Analyze, design, and implement modifications to system software to improve and enhance system performance by correcting errors 
  • Plan new hardware acquisitions, interact with vendors, educate customers, and collaborate with other projects within the organization 
  • Work closely with engineers to help them use workstations and servers to solve their computationally intensive problems 
  • Support application installation, license management, software tracking / distribution and backup/recovery of system configurations and user data files 
  • Understand and use essential tools for handling files, directories, command-line environments, and documentation
  • Operate running systems, including booting into different run levels, identifying processes, starting and stopping virtual machines, and controlling services 
  • Configure local storage using partitions and logical volumes 
  • Create and configure file systems and file system attributes, such as permissions, encryption, access control lists, and network file systems 
  • Deploy, configure, and maintain systems, including software installation, update, and core services 
  • Manage users and groups, including use of a centralized directory for authentication 
  • Manage security, including basic firewall and SELinux configuration 
  • Configure static routes, packet filtering, and network address translation
  • Set kernel runtime parameters 
  • Produce and deliver reports on system utilization 
  • Use shell scripting to automate system maintenance tasks 
  • Configuring system logging, including remote logging
  • Configure a system to provide networking services, including HTTP/HTTPS, DNS, SMTP, SSH and NTP

Qualifications

  • Minimum three - six years' (3-6) experience in system administration of Linux-based servers and Linux-based workstations
  • Ideal Linux Admin will have troubleshooting skills in RHEL 7/8/9 OS and basic knowledge of Networking fundamentals, specifically TCP/IP protocol suite and IP configuration
  • In addition, working knowledge of security guidelines and polices (DISA STIGs) and tools (Evaluate-STIG, STIG-Manager)
  • Knowledge of / experience with Tenable suite of products (Security Center, Nessus Scanner, Nessus Agent) is a plus
  • Seeking specific experience with the following operating systems and services is required: Red Hat Enterprise Linux (RHEL 8.x with RHEL 7.x and/or RHEL9.x a plus)
  • Must meet DoD 8570 Information Assurance Workforce (IAWF) criteria or Information Assurance Technical (IAT) Level II certification at time of hire (i.e., Security ).
  • Have knowledge of corporate services including: DNS, SMTP, Splunk, Centralized patching solutions such as Red Hat Satellite, Automation solutions such as Ansible Tower / AWX
  • Knowledge of / experience with: Single Sign on solutions such as RHSSO; Virtualization platform management systems such as VMWare / VSphere / Vcenter is a plus
  • Demonstrated experience managing the installation and maintenance of IT infrastructure
  • Experience working in an environment with rapidly changing job priorities
  • Experience with Service Now or similar Ticket Management system
  • Linux or Red Hat Certification preferred

Physical Demands:

  • Must be able to lift up to 10-15 pounds 
  • Must be able to stand and walk for prolonged amounts of time 
  • Must be able to twist, bend and squat periodically

SECURITY CLEARANCE REQUIREMENTS: Must be able to obtain and maintain a security clearance at the Top Secret level. US Citizenship is a requirement for this contract.
